Canadian Red Elderberry

The Canadian Red Elderberry is a native fruit known for its vibrant red color and rich antioxidant properties. It is often used in traditional medicine and culinary applications.

Rich in antioxidants, Canadian Red Elderberry may help reduce oxidative stress and inflammation in the body.
Contains high levels of Vitamin C, which supports immune function and skin health.

American Elderberry

American Elderberry is a small, dark purple fruit known for its high antioxidant content and potential immune-boosting properties. It is often used in syrups and jams for its flavor and health benefits.

Rich in antioxidants, American Elderberry may help reduce oxidative stress and inflammation in the body.
Contains high levels of vitamin C, which supports immune function and skin health.
